Lui Hock Seng: Passing Time

A solo exhibition by Lui Hock Seng

Passing Time presents a slice of history through black and white photographs of Singapore from the 1960s to 1970s, captured by 81-year old self-taught photographer Lui Hock Seng.

Mr Lui’s interest in photography started in the 1950s. A car mechanic by profession and a photographer by vocation, Mr Lui was an avid participant in photography excursions organised by photo clubs and his friends. He would even take photos while cycling to work, shooting life by the Merdeka Bridge.

Like many photographers of that period, his subjects of interest ranged widely from streetscapes, to portraits, from architecture to industry. The images are exemplary of pictorial photography, the dominant photography art practice at the time, and provide insight into the beginnings of modern-day Singapore. In its emphasis on composition, light, technical skill and individual expression, pictorial photography saw many photographers exercise extensive control over the image-making process, from capturing the subject to manipulating the outcome in the darkroom.

Although Mr Lui has not pursued photography professionally, he has taken part in several photo competitions over the years, winning awards and was even accepted as an Associate of The Royal Photographic Society (ARPS) of Great Britain (1963). Most recently, he won a 3rd prize (Colour) at the Kampong Glam Community Club (2016).

He continues to take photographs to this day. 

About Lui Hock Seng

Mr Lui Hock Seng, 81 years old has been taking photographs of Singapore since the 1950s. He is a self- taught photographer who has worked as a part time event photographer for weddings, dinners and funerals in the 60s. He was a member of the now defunct South-east Asia Photographic Society and has won several photography awards in the past. He is currently working as an office cleaner.
